Output 2858b56102a4f504b96653b4d4d2b43fed994e571b66837a9c01ddc2904dd65e:1

value
1027597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fbbc6170f5f08a98b6eb2bd2f02c617775ea6f OP_EQUAL
address
35haYhwrdJ1nHLUsQXYP1HbPNWu1ecPrsR
transaction
2858b56102a4f504b96653b4d4d2b43fed994e571b66837a9c01ddc2904dd65e
spent
true